Terms of the peace settlements of 1919-20, what is meant by the terms war guilt and reparations?

History
1 answer:
HACTEHA [7]2 years ago
3 0

Answer:

The treaty's so-called “war guilt” clause forced Germany and other Central Powers to take all the blame for World War I. ... This meant a loss of territories, reduction in military forces, and reparation payments to Allied powers.
